What is Applied Machine Learning?

Applied machine learning involves the use of machine learning algorithms and models to solve real-world problems. It involves collecting and analyzing data, identifying patterns and trends, and using this information to make predictions or decisions. Machine learning models can be trained on large datasets to detect patterns that might not be visible to humans, and can then use this knowledge to make predictions on new data.

The Benefits of Applied Machine Learning

One of the biggest benefits of applied machine learning is the ability to automate processes and reduce human error. Machine learning algorithms can analyze vast amounts of data in a fraction of the time it would take a human, and can do so with greater accuracy. This can lead to increased efficiency and productivity, as well as better decision-making.

Another advantage of applied machine learning is the ability to uncover insights that might not be apparent to humans. By analyzing large datasets, machine learning algorithms can identify patterns and trends that might be missed by human analysts. This can lead to new discoveries and insights that can help businesses make better decisions.

Real-World Examples of Applied Machine Learning

There are many examples of applied machine learning in use today. One such example is in healthcare, where machine learning algorithms are being used to analyze medical records and help doctors make better diagnoses. Machine learning models can analyze large datasets of medical records to identify patterns and risk factors, and can then make predictions on new patient data.

In finance, machine learning algorithms are being used to detect fraudulent activity and prevent financial crimes. By analyzing transaction data, machine learning models can identify patterns of fraudulent behavior and alert authorities to potential criminal activity.

In retail, machine learning is being used to personalize the shopping experience for customers. By analyzing purchase history and browsing behavior, retailers can make personalized product recommendations and improve the customer experience.
